33 /// @class BreakpointLocation BreakpointLocation.h "lldb/Breakpoint/BreakpointLocation.h"
34 /// @brief Class that manages one unique (by address) instance of a logical breakpoint.
35 //----------------------------------------------------------------------
37 //----------------------------------------------------------------------
39 /// A breakpoint location is defined by the breakpoint that produces it,
40 /// and the address that resulted in this particular instantiation.
41 /// Each breakpoint location also may have a breakpoint site if its
42 /// address has been loaded into the program.
43 /// Finally it has a settable options object.
45 /// FIXME: Should we also store some fingerprint for the location, so
46 /// we can map one location to the "equivalent location" on rerun? This
47 /// would be useful if you've set options on the locations.
